Biography

Jeanne Marie Tripplehorn (born June 10, 1963) is an American actress. She began her career in theatre, acting in several plays throughout the early 1990s, including Anton Chekhov's *Three Sisters* on Broadway. Her film career began with the role of a police psychologist in the erotic thriller *Basic Instinct* (1992). Her other film roles include *The Firm* (1993), *Waterworld* (1995), and *Sliding Doors* (1998). On television, she starred as Barbara Henrickson on the HBO drama series *Big Love* (2006–11) and as Dr. Alex Blake on the CBS police drama *Criminal Minds* (2012–14), and she received a Primetime Emmy Award nomination for her performance as Jacqueline Kennedy Onassis in the 2009 HBO movie *Grey Gardens*.
